POSITION SUMMARY:

The hands-on Accounting Manager oversees the day-to-day activities of the accounting department, including tracking and auditing financial information, analyzing financial records and transactions and managing the accounting team members.

PREFERRED E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ting and/or equivalent work experience and relevant certifications strongly preferred
  • Five years or more of related experience; non-profit accounting experience preferred.
  • Proficient in accounting software, preferably QuickBooks, Sage Intacct and Bill.com.
  • Advanced Microsoft Excel skills.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

  • Prolonged periods sitting at a desk and working on a computer.
Responsibilities

S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Manages the accounting staff who are responsible for financial reporting, billing, collections, and budget preparation.
  • Recruits and hires accounting and financial staff and conducts performance evaluations.
  • Coordinates training programs for new staff and identifies training needs for current staff.

DUTIES:

  • Supervise accounting staff in maintenance of general ledger, accounts payable, payroll, cash receipts, pledges receivable and contributions, accounts receivable, fixed asset and purchase orders
  • Establishes internal controls and guidelines for accounting transactions and budget preparation.
  • Oversees preparation of business activity reports, financial forecasts, and annual budgets.
  • Produces monthly financial reports; ensures that the reported results comply with generally accepted accounting principles or financial reporting standards.
  • Audits accounts and prepares reconciliation schedules to ensure accuracy; coordinates with outside auditors and provides needed information for the annual external audit.
  • Presents recommendations to management on short- and long-term financial objectives and policies.
  • Manages cash flow including preparation of forecasted cash positions
  • Reconciles bank and investment accounts.
  • Prepares grant compliance reports
  • Develops and implements operational best-practices and maintain procedures, policies, and internal controls
